Can moxibustion be used for swollen and painful gums?

I don't know why, but my gums have been swollen and painful for the past couple of days. A friend recommended that I try moxibustion. Can moxibustion help with swollen and painful gums?

In general, moxibustion should not be performed when experiencing swollen and painful gums. This is mainly because such symptoms are mostly caused by excessive internal heat, and applying moxibustion may worsen the discomfort. It is recommended that patients, after developing swollen and painful gums, consult a doctor and take anti-inflammatory medications accordingly. Commonly used drugs include amoxicillin and levofloxacin.
